About TBHC

Founded in 1966 and headquartered in Brentwood, Tennessee, The Brand House Collective, Inc., formerly known as Kirkland's, Inc., has evolved into a prominent specialty retailer in the home décor and furnishings sector. The company operates a network of stores under various banners, including Kirkland's, Kirkland's Home, Kirkland's Home Outlet, Kirkland's Outlet, and Kirkland Collection, catering to a broad customer base seeking affordable and stylish home accents. Their comprehensive product assortment encompasses holiday décor, furniture, textiles, ornamental wall décor, decorative accessories, art, mirrors, home fragrance, lighting, floral, housewares, outdoor items, and gifts. In addition to its brick-and-mortar presence, The Brand House Collective maintains a robust e-commerce platform, kirklands.com, extending its reach to customers nationwide. The company's strategic focus on providing value-driven merchandise and a compelling shopping experience has solidified its position in the competitive home décor market. The name change in July 2025 to The Brand House Collective, Inc. reflects an evolution to a more diversified brand strategy.

What does The Brand House Collective, Inc. do?

The Brand House Collective, Inc. operates as a specialty retailer in the United States, focusing on home décor and furnishings. It offers a wide array of products, including holiday décor, furniture, textiles, wall décor, accessories, art, mirrors, and more, through its various store formats like Kirkland's and Kirkland's Home. Additionally, the company has a significant online presence through its e-commerce platform, kirklands.com. TBHC aims to provide affordable and stylish home accents to a broad customer base, competing in a fragmented market against both large retailers and niche players.
